Why AI matters at this scale
Marian University Indianapolis, a mid-sized private Catholic university founded in 1937, operates in a fiercely competitive higher education landscape. With 201-500 employees and an estimated annual revenue around $65 million, the institution faces the classic challenges of regional private colleges: enrollment pressure, student retention, and operational efficiency with limited resources. AI adoption at this scale is not about building custom models but about strategically deploying proven, vendor-integrated tools that deliver immediate ROI. Unlike large research universities with dedicated AI labs, Marian can leapfrog by adopting turnkey solutions that personalize student experiences and automate administrative burdens, directly impacting its bottom line and mission.
Concrete AI Opportunities with ROI
1. Predictive Retention to Protect Tuition Revenue. The highest-impact opportunity is an AI-driven student success platform. By integrating data from the LMS (Canvas), SIS (likely Ellucian), and campus engagement systems, machine learning models can identify students at risk of dropping out weeks before midterms. Automated alerts to academic advisors and personalized nudges to students can improve retention by even 3-5 percentage points, representing millions in preserved tuition revenue over a few years. The ROI is direct and measurable.
2. AI-Enhanced Enrollment Marketing. With the enrollment cliff looming, every inquiry is precious. An AI layer on top of a CRM like Slate or Salesforce can score prospects, predict likelihood to enroll, and automate personalized communication journeys. Generative AI can also produce high-quality, program-specific content for landing pages and emails at scale, reducing the marketing team's content production time by over 70% and allowing them to focus on strategy. The expected ROI is a lower cost-per-enrolled student and a stronger incoming class.
3. Operational Efficiency in Advancement and Administration. Fundraising is the lifeblood of a private university. AI tools can analyze alumni giving history, wealth screenings, and engagement data to identify major gift prospects and suggest optimal ask amounts and timing. On the administrative side, intelligent automation can streamline financial aid verification and transcript processing, freeing up staff for higher-value student support. These efficiency gains directly translate to cost savings and increased gift revenue.
Deployment Risks for a Mid-Sized Institution
For a university of this size, the primary risks are not technical but organizational. First, data silos are common; student information, LMS activity, and financial data often reside in separate systems with poor integration. Any AI initiative must start with a data mapping exercise. Second, change management is critical. Faculty and staff may fear job displacement or distrust algorithmic recommendations. A transparent, human-in-the-loop approach where AI augments rather than replaces decision-making is essential. Third, bias and fairness in predictive models must be proactively audited to avoid perpetuating historical inequities in student support and admissions. Finally, vendor lock-in and cost require careful contract negotiation, ensuring that AI features are not priced as prohibitive add-ons. Starting with a pilot in one area, like retention, allows the institution to build internal buy-in and demonstrate value before scaling.
